Shoyu Sushi-Grade Ahi Tuna Poke-Style Bowl

Five minutes of knife work, then lunch tastes like the beach.

🍽️ Hawaiian ⏱️ 15 min prep · 0 min cook 👥 Serves 2 📊 Beginner

Method

  1. Use sushi-grade fish from a fishmonger you trust and keep it cold until the last minute — raw dishes have no margin for maybes. (Tofu skips the worry entirely: press and cube it.)
  2. Toss the Sushi-Grade Ahi Tuna gently with the soy sauce, sesame oil, sweet onion, scallions, and sesame seeds. Let it marinate 5–10 minutes in the fridge.
  3. Spoon rice into bowls and arrange the Cucumber and Avocado alongside.
  4. Pile the Sushi-Grade Ahi Tuna on top, spoon over any marinade left in the bowl, and finish with furikake.
